1. The Role of a Criminal Defense Attorney:
Throughout your preliminary appointment, your lawyer will clarify their duty in the legal process. They will talk about just how they will support for your rights, explore your situation, and develop a solid defense approach in your place. This is an essential opportunity for you to comprehend the attorney's strategy and determine if they are the best suitable for your situation.

2. Conversation of Your Case:
You will have the possibility to supply your lawyer with a detailed account of the events leading up to your arrest or fees. It is essential to be sincere and open, as this details will certainly assist your lawyer evaluate the staminas and weak points of your case. They might ask you certain concerns to gather more info and clarify any kind of information.

3. Analysis of Evidence:
Your attorney will certainly assess any kind of evidence that has actually existed against you. This might consist of cops reports, witness statements, forensic proof, or monitoring video. They will examine the evidence to identify its relevance and prospective influence on your instance.

4. Defense Techniques and Lawful Alternatives:
Based on the information you supply and the evidence evaluated, your lawyer will talk about prospective protection strategies and lawful options. They will clarify the staminas and weaknesses of each technique and help you recognize the potential end results. This is a chance for you to ask questions and acquire a clear understanding of your defense strategy moving forward.

5. Charge Structure and Legal Costs:
Your attorney will discuss their fee structure and any associated legal prices throughout the preliminary consultation. This is an important conversation to have upfront to ensure you understand the financial ramifications of employing legal representation. They might also talk about layaway plan or choices for funding legal fees.

6. Confidentiality and Attorney-Client Privilege:
Your lawyer will certainly emphasize the relevance of discretion and attorney-client privilege. They will certainly describe that anything you review throughout the examination is shielded by legislation and will certainly not be shared with anybody without your approval. This is critical for establishing trust and guaranteeing open communication throughout your situation.

7. Next Steps:
At the end of the examination, your lawyer will certainly detail the next steps in the legal process. This may include gathering added evidence, filing activities, negotiating with the prosecution, or preparing for trial. They will certainly offer you with a clear timeline and maintain you educated regarding any kind of vital growths in your instance.
